Release checklist — FabrikForge test-data factory. Confirm all factory presets regenerate deterministic fixtures under the new seed scheme. Verify no leftover snapshot files from the 3.x migration remain in the fixtures directory. Run the full generation suite twice and diff outputs; they must match byte-for-byte. Tag only after the diff is clean. The verified build token is recorded below.

build token for yajef-kagef: htk14_cbbee23b70220b

**Changelog: VramScope defaults shuffle**

Heads up for the sync: VramScope 2.4 changes its default sampling behavior. We now profile GPU memory at 250ms intervals instead of 1s, and per-kernel attribution is on by default. Yes, that means slightly more overhead (~2%), but the Tesslin team kept hitting OOMs that the old coarse sampling missed entirely. Snapshot retention also dropped from 14 days to 7 to keep disk usage sane. If you need the old behavior, override locally. Current defaults shipping with 2.4 are as follows.

service settings:
[ulair]
team = praath
access_code = ac_06d704
owner = wenix.ulair
host = ulair.qirvancorp.corp
port = 9200
peer = sorys.nelvronet.internal
salt = 2668132c
pin = 9140

## Marrowtail Environments — log tailing

The `mtail` CLI is the supported way to tail Marrowtail logs across environments. It authenticates via the standard dev token and resolves endpoints per environment automatically; never hardcode hosts. Staging and production differ only in retention and rate limits. The CLI reads its per-environment defaults from the following configuration.

service settings:
[pelius]
port = 5432
team = praius
host = pelius.crelvoforge.internal
region = upper-4
access_code = ac_8f224d
timeout_ms = 2000